Monthly Pass Value in Where Winds Meet (Rewards & Comparison)

The Monthly Pass in Where Winds Meet costs approximately $5 and delivers a bundle of premium and farmable currencies alongside access to a dedicated shop. Players receive 300 Echo Beads and 90,000 Coins immediately upon purchase, plus 100 Echo Jade and 50 Battle Pass EXP every day for 30 days. The pass also unlocks a VIP Shop that sells outfit save slots, gender transformation pills, and other convenience items for Echo Jade.

Quick answer: The Monthly Pass offers better Echo Bead value than direct top-ups at the same price point, but its daily Echo Jade rewards are farmable through trial bounties and exploration. It is most useful for players who want Echo Beads for cosmetics, need VIP Shop access, or prefer steady daily login rewards over grinding.


Instant Rewards and Daily Login Bonuses

Purchasing the Monthly Pass grants 300 Echo Beads and 90,000 Coins on the spot. Echo Beads are the premium currency used to buy cosmetic outfits, hairstyles, and other appearance items in the shop. A direct $5 top-up package provides only 300 Echo Beads with no extras, making the Monthly Pass equivalent in bead value but superior in total rewards.

Each day you log in during the 30-day pass period, you claim 100 Echo Jade and 50 Battle Pass EXP. Echo Jade is the standard gacha currency for the free-to-play banner, which offers cosmetic items and weapon skins. Over the full month, you accumulate 3,000 Echo Jade and 1,500 Battle Pass EXP, plus one Lingering Melody (a premium gacha ticket) as a bonus reward.

The pass advertises a "total value of approximately 3,600 Echo Beads" and a "1200% bountiful yield." This calculation treats the Echo Jade, Coins, and Battle Pass EXP as if they were purchased with Echo Beads at shop conversion rates. The 300 Echo Beads you receive upfront match the cost of a $5 top-up, so the advertised multiplier reflects the added value of the daily login items rather than additional Echo Beads.

VIP Shop Access and Exclusive Items

Active Monthly Pass holders unlock the VIP Shop, which sells three rotating items for Echo Jade:

  • Dreamtint Kit (25 Echo Jade): A dye kit that applies a specific color palette to dyeable outfits.
  • Transformation Pill (6,400 Echo Jade): Allows you to change your character's gender and completely reshape their appearance. This item is not available outside the VIP Shop.
  • Message Horn: Far (50 Echo Jade): A broadcast item that sends a server-wide message.

The Transformation Pill is the most notable exclusive. Without the Monthly Pass, you cannot access this item at all. Players who want to change their character's gender or appearance after creation must either buy the Monthly Pass or start a new character slot.

The VIP Shop also offers outfit save slots, which let you store and swap between multiple appearance presets without manually re-equipping each piece. These slots cost Echo Jade and are purchased individually.

Echo Jade Farming and Gacha Banners

Echo Jade is farmable through trial bounties, exploration chests, quest rewards, and daily login events. A single trial bounty run can yield more than 100 Echo Jade, which matches the daily login reward from the Monthly Pass. Players who complete multiple bounties or explore actively can accumulate Echo Jade faster than the pass provides.

The standard gacha banner uses Echo Jade and guarantees a cosmetic item after a set number of pulls. Future updates are expected to introduce limited Echo Jade banners that require 150 pulls on the standard banner to unlock. These limited banners will have a 24,000 Echo Jade guarantee for the featured item. The Monthly Pass provides 3,000 Echo Jade per month, which contributes to this total but does not cover the full guarantee on its own.

Farmable Echo Jade is technically finite. Once you exhaust exploration chests, quest rewards, and one-time sources, your daily income depends on trial bounties and event rewards. The Monthly Pass adds a steady 100 Echo Jade per day without requiring active play, which can be useful for players who log in but do not farm daily.

Comparison to Battle Pass and Direct Top-Ups

The Battle Pass costs $10 for the base Elite tier and provides energy pills, premium dye powder, Lingering Melodies, and a dyeable outfit. Light spenders often consider the Battle Pass a better value than the Monthly Pass because it includes progression materials and a guaranteed cosmetic. The Battle Pass also grants access to portable merchants, extra medicine slots, and inventory capacity, which are convenience features not tied to the Monthly Pass.

A $5 direct top-up gives 300 Echo Beads with no daily rewards or VIP Shop access. The Monthly Pass costs the same but adds 3,000 Echo Jade, 90,000 Coins, 1,500 Battle Pass EXP, and one Lingering Melody over 30 days. If you plan to spend $5 on Echo Beads anyway, the Monthly Pass is strictly better.

Stacking multiple Monthly Passes is possible up to a cap of five or six active passes at once. Each pass extends your daily login rewards by 30 days and adds another 300 Echo Beads to your balance immediately. Players who want to save Echo Beads for a 2,580-bead outfit can stack passes over several months, using discount vouchers to reduce the final outfit cost by half.

Who Benefits Most from the Monthly Pass

The Monthly Pass is most valuable for players who:

  • Want Echo Beads for cosmetic purchases and prefer the added daily rewards over a direct top-up.
  • Need access to the Transformation Pill or outfit save slots in the VIP Shop.
  • Log in daily and want a passive Echo Jade income without grinding trial bounties.
  • Plan to pull on limited Echo Jade banners in future updates and want to stockpile currency.

The pass is less useful for players who farm Echo Jade actively through bounties and exploration, since the daily 100 Echo Jade reward is easily matched by one or two trial runs. It also does not provide progression materials like energy pills or Inner Way chests, so it does not accelerate gear farming or breakthrough progress.

Free-to-play players can ignore the Monthly Pass without harming their progression. All gameplay systems, including gear farming, mystic skill upgrades, and PvP, are accessible without spending. The pass only affects cosmetic acquisition speed and VIP Shop access.


Must-Buy List and Portable Merchant Features

The Monthly Pass does not directly unlock portable merchants. That feature is tied to the Battle Pass Elite tier. However, the pass does allow you to use the Must-Buy List feature in the shop, which lets you favorite specific items from various vendors and purchase them from a single menu without traveling to each NPC.

To add an item to the Must-Buy List, open the shop menu, navigate to the vendor or season shop tab, select the item, and click the star icon in the item detail window. The item then appears in the Must-Buy List under the Offers tab. You can purchase favorited items directly from this list, which saves time when restocking consumables or buying weekly dyes.

The Must-Buy List is a convenience feature that works independently of the Monthly Pass, but players who buy the pass often use it to streamline purchases of dye kits, medicine, and seasonal materials.


The Monthly Pass in Where Winds Meet is a light-spending option that prioritizes cosmetic currency and convenience over progression materials. It offers better value than a direct $5 top-up and provides exclusive access to the Transformation Pill, but it does not replace active farming for players who want to maximize Echo Jade income. The decision to buy depends on whether you value daily login rewards, VIP Shop access, and passive currency accumulation over the immediate progression benefits of the Battle Pass or the flexibility of staying free-to-play.
